Great for Poison Ivy
I had poison ivy near my elbow and this really saved the day. I kept rubbing my elbow on chair arms, etc and it was hard to keep it covered and protected otherwise. Also any effort to put sticky bandages on the rash was just making it worse. Be sure to get the gauze pads and slide them under the elastic net over the wound. It makes for easy adjustments and adding of more cream. It's easy to let it breathe too. Periodically you can just slide it down your arm and air things out. You also get a ton of it. I was able to use one cut of the dressing for over a week. It is a bit itchy if you have hair on your arm/leg but you can lift the dressing up over where it itches and let go. It will then sit better on your hair and be less itchy. It's also easy to scratch or adjust the tension by sliding it. It also loosens a bit after you've had it on for awhile. When you first put it on it's tighter but not painful or anything. It's really good to have this in your first aid stuff. You won't need it a lot but when you do it really helps you out.
